Expects to record second quarter revenues of $22.7-23.0 million, up 18% to 20% compared to the second quarter last year
HERZLIYA, Israel, July 8 /PRNewswire-FirstCall/ -- BluePhoenix Solutions (Nasdaq: BPHX), the leader in value-driven legacy modernization, today provided additional visibility into its expected second quarter 2008 financial results. This information is intended to supplement the preliminary earnings guidance provided on June 19, 2008.
Arik Kilman, CEO of BluePhoenix commented, "Based on a preliminary review of our second quarter results, revenues are expected to be in the range of $22.7 to $23.0 million for the second quarter of 2008, up approximately 18% to 20% compared to $19.2 million in last year's same period. Challenging global economic conditions, particularly related to IT spending have resulted in a somewhat longer sales cycle, and as such, our ability to forecast the timing of revenue recognition is proving more difficult than normal."
"We have maintained a healthy pipeline and we are actively engaged in discussions with both new prospects and current customers for follow-on projects, some of which are sizable," Mr. Kilman continued. "We continued to book new projects throughout the second quarter despite the global economic conditions, and are seeing a particularly nice pick-up in AS400 business, as our ANSA subsidiary continues to grow."

About BluePhoenix Solutions
BluePhoenix Solutions (Nasdaq: BPHX) is a leading provider of value-driven modernization solutions for legacy information systems. BluePhoenix offerings include a comprehensive suite of tools and services from global IT asset assessment and impact analysis to automated database and application migration, re-hosting, and renewal. Leveraging over 20 years of best-practice domain expertise, BluePhoenix works closely with its customers to ascertain which assets should be migrated, redeveloped, or wrapped for reuse as services or business processes, to protect and increase the value of their business applications and legacy systems with minimized risk and downtime.
BluePhoenix provides modernization solutions to companies from diverse industries and vertical markets such as automotive, banking and financial services, insurance, manufacturing, and retail. Among its prestigious customers are: Aflac, CareFirst, Citigroup, Danish Commerce and Companies Agency, Desjardins, Los Angeles County Employees Retirement Association, Merrill Lynch, Rabobank, Rural Servicios Informaticos, SDC Udvikling, TEMENOS, Toyota and Volvofinans. BluePhoenix has 15 offices in the USA, UK, Denmark, Germany, Italy, France, The Netherlands, Romania, Russia, Cyprus, South Korea, Australia, and Israel.
